Maria Vicente-Puletti
Maria Vicente-Puletti, was born in Buenos Aires, Argentina and immigrated to the United States with her family at a young age. She is a Licensed Clinical Social worker with a Masters degree in Social Work, with over 30 years of working in healthcare.
Maria's late husband was a physician at St. Luke's and they both shared a long and strong commitment to the mission of the hospital as well as the community it serves.
Presently, Maria is a Trustee of CPMC's Foundation, President of the Auxiliary at St. Luke’s, a member of the Hospital's Community Advisory Board (recently advising the Blue Ribbon Panel, that recommended the rebuild of St. Luke's) and on the board of two small non-profits.
Maria works part-time for St. Luke's Health Care Center as a Medical Social Worker. She lives in San Francisco.
